I tried everything I could think of, but... Seems to work on MacOS Catalina. If you add a Test/ file for "make check" we'll get more coverage. Documentation suggestions: -s SCALAR Save the random data in SCALAR instead of printing it. Only useful in string mode or when LENGTH is 1. Actually say that this is an error for -i with length > 1, rather than just "Only useful when". Avoids use of the undefined term "string mode" and better describes the behavior. I wonder if using both -i and -s should default length to 1 rather than 8 ... otherwise you should state that you can't use them together without also using -l. I'd have put -L before -U but I suppose you expect -U to be used more frequently.
